Radio frequency needling device for use with disposable needle cartridges

This is a handheld device for skin treatments that uses tiny needles to deliver radio frequency (RF) energy. It features a motor to rapidly extend and retract disposable needles into the skin, while integrated electronics generate RF energy and transfer it directly through these needles. The patent specifically details the RF circuitry within the main body and its connection to the needles via electrical pathways, powered by a removable battery.

Why it matters: Improvements in battery energy density and miniaturization of RF components since 2017 could make a compact, integrated, and portable device with disposable cartridges more cost-effective to manufacture and operate.
